The evolution of personnel costs in municipalities and cooperation structures among municipalities

Abstract:
The efficiency of the cooperation structures among municipalities (intercommunality) is regularly discussed, especially as to personnel management and costs. Sharp judgment to this regard needs to me mitigated. National measures influence the evolution of these costs alongside local ones. Intercommunal structures were created as a way to mutualise and then to induce a decrease in associated municipalities' payroll. At present, the impacts of this creation are diversified and mixed, even if a common trend emerges in terms of mutualisation of associated municipalities' personnel costs.
